13 |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Renee Campbell and LPA Victoria Brown arrived unannounced to conduct an investigation of the above allegation on 09/27/2023 at 9:00 am. LPA’s Campbell and Brown met with Janet Johns, Assistant Executive Director, and explained the purpose of the visit.
Regarding the Allegation, Staff handled resident in a rough manner, of the 6 staff and 4 residents interviewed, none stated that they had witnessed, experienced, or heard of any resident being treated in a rough or inappropriate manner. Based on interviews with a random amount of residents and staff the investigation revealed that there is no preponderace of evidence. Allegation is deemed UNSUBSTANTIATED.
A finding of Unsubstantiated means that although the allegation may have happened or is valid, there is not a preponderance of the evidence to prove that the alleged violation occurred. Per California Code of Regulations (CCRs) - Title 22, Division 6, Chapter 8, no deficiencies cited. An exit interview was conducted, copy of the report provided. |
